Русское сообщество по скриптингу

SuperBan 4.12 Quckly modification

Утвержденные плагины для AMX Mod X администратором/модератором форума.

Модератор: Leonidddd

Правила форума
1. Запрещено материться и оскорблять других участников форума.
2. Запрещен флуд, оффтоп, дабл постинг во всех разделах форума, кроме раздела "Болтовня".
3. Запрещено взламывать сайт/форум или наносить любой вред проекту.
4. Запрещено рекламировать другие ресурсы.
5. Запрещено создавать темы без информативного названия. Название темы должно отображать ее смысл.

В данном разделе форума разрешено создавать темы, касающие только работоспособных плагинов для AMX Mod X. Новые плагины нужно выкладывать в разделе "Новые плагины".

SuperBan 4.12 Quckly modification

Сообщение quckly » 25 янв 2014, 18:52

Версия: 1.0

Улучшенная версия SuperBan 4.12, в которой множество исправлений и улучшений.

Изменения:
1. Замена cvar на pcvar.
2. Убрана блокировка чата и голосового чата.
3. Улучшено отображение времени.
4. При бане в консоле, при совпадении нескольких игроков, они выводятся в консоль.
5. Сделал экранирование символов mysql запросов.
6. Добавлен цветной чат. Можно выводить сообщение и в чат и в худ. amx_superban_messages.
7. Изменен ланг и конфиг (Добавлены квары и фразы).
8. Оптимизированы SQL запросы.
9. Вместо 7 !!! запросов проверки игрока 1.
10. Блокирующие запросы к базе заменены на асинхронные
11. При выводе списка банов в консоль ИЗ БАЗЫ ЗАПРАШИВАЛИСЬ ВСЕ БАНЫ !!! (Вот почему лагало) Добавлен "LIMIT %d". Список пишется не всем, а только админу.
12. Изменен ban.php. Добавлен квар времени кика. Добавлен показ motd забаненому игроку.
13. При разбане через консоль, разбаниваются только активные баны.
14. Сделал в меню желтые цифры.


Если есть какие-то баги или замечания, пишем в этой теме. Так же можете написать свои предложения, одно я уже сделал (4).

Что планируется изменить:
1. Добавить бан вышедших игроков.


Source code: Вы должны зарегистрироваться, чтобы видеть ссылки.
Assets:
superban_10.04.2016.zip


Утверждено. //Leonidddd
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Последний раз редактировалось quckly 09 апр 2016, 23:46, всего редактировалось 5 раз(а).
Аватара пользователя
quckly
Скриптер
 
Сообщения: 403
Зарегистрирован: 20 ноя 2009, 10:03
Благодарил (а): 41 раз.
Поблагодарили: 243 раз.
Опыт программирования: Около 6 месяцев
Языки программирования: Counter-Strike 1.6

Re: SuperBan 4.12 Quckly modification

Сообщение quckly » 05 фев 2014, 19:12

BaHeK, работает?
Аватара пользователя
quckly
Скриптер
 
Сообщения: 403
Зарегистрирован: 20 ноя 2009, 10:03
Благодарил (а): 41 раз.
Поблагодарили: 243 раз.
Опыт программирования: Около 6 месяцев
Языки программирования: Counter-Strike 1.6

Re: SuperBan 4.12 Quckly modification

Сообщение quckly » 06 фев 2014, 14:06

Проверка лицензии теперь работает.
Аватара пользователя
quckly
Скриптер
 
Сообщения: 403
Зарегистрирован: 20 ноя 2009, 10:03
Благодарил (а): 41 раз.
Поблагодарили: 243 раз.
Опыт программирования: Около 6 месяцев
Языки программирования: Counter-Strike 1.6

Re: SuperBan 4.12 Quckly modification

Сообщение VenGi » 06 фев 2014, 14:32

quckly писал(а):...
Попробуй:
superban.amxx


Добавлено спустя 18 секунд:
Скоро будет новая версия.


Попробовал, вот что получилось:
06/02/2014 - 13:19:32: Plugin stopped, because can't connect to license.superban.net | api_response: {"license":2,"url":"http:\/\/license.superban.net\/license.html","key":"[ключ]"}
Аватара пользователя
VenGi
 
Сообщения: 1
Зарегистрирован: 30 янв 2014, 00:42
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.
Опыт программирования: Больше трех лет
Языки программирования: Counter-Strike 1.6

Re: SuperBan 4.12 Quckly modification

Сообщение Evgen {22Rus} » 06 фев 2014, 14:53

quckly писал(а):Проверка лицензии теперь работает.

Теперь да, но в логах...
Код: Выделить всё
L 02/06/2014 - 14:48:45: [AMXX] To enable debug mode, add "debug" after the plugin name in plugins.ini (without quotes).

после поставил superban.amxx debug и вот
Код: Выделить всё
L 02/06/2014 - 14:49:36: Start of error session.
L 02/06/2014 - 14:49:36: Info (map "de_dust2_2x2") (file "addons/amxmodx/logs/error_20140206.log")
L 02/06/2014 - 14:49:36: [AMXX] Displaying debug trace (plugin "superban.amxx")
L 02/06/2014 - 14:49:36: [AMXX] Run time error 3: stack error
L 02/06/2014 - 14:49:36: [AMXX]    [0] superban.sma::CheckLicense_ (line 410)


Добавлено спустя 1 минуту 43 секунды:
quckly, и команда amx_superbanmenu не работает
Не забывай отблагодарить кнопкой "Спасибо" :)
Ну или...
[spoiler]Также не откажусь от материальной помощи :)
R117018462390 - Webmoney (Аттестован)
41001534741802 - Yandex money (Идентифицирован)[/spoiler]
Аватара пользователя
Evgen {22Rus}
 
Сообщения: 67
Зарегистрирован: 09 окт 2012, 18:17
Откуда: Рубцовск
Благодарил (а): 8 раз.
Поблагодарили: 8 раз.
Опыт программирования: Около года
Языки программирования: Counter-Strike 1.6

Re: SuperBan 4.12 Quckly modification

Сообщение VenGi » 06 фев 2014, 16:05

Установил последнюю версию:
- в первый раз проверка лицензии сработала, но в логах наблюдал много ошибок. поставил плагин в дебаг;
- второй раз (с дебагом) плагин выдал: "Plugin stopped, because incorrect ID file".
Аватара пользователя
VenGi
 
Сообщения: 1
Зарегистрирован: 30 янв 2014, 00:42
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.
Опыт программирования: Больше трех лет
Языки программирования: Counter-Strike 1.6

Re: SuperBan 4.12 Quckly modification

Сообщение Evgen {22Rus} » 06 фев 2014, 21:54

Ну у кого работает данный плагин? :) Отпишитесь, я тоже поставлю :)
Не забывай отблагодарить кнопкой "Спасибо" :)
Ну или...
[spoiler]Также не откажусь от материальной помощи :)
R117018462390 - Webmoney (Аттестован)
41001534741802 - Yandex money (Идентифицирован)[/spoiler]
Аватара пользователя
Evgen {22Rus}
 
Сообщения: 67
Зарегистрирован: 09 окт 2012, 18:17
Откуда: Рубцовск
Благодарил (а): 8 раз.
Поблагодарили: 8 раз.
Опыт программирования: Около года
Языки программирования: Counter-Strike 1.6

Re: SuperBan 4.12 Quckly modification

Сообщение BaHeK » 06 фев 2014, 22:30

Evgen {22Rus} писал(а):Ну у кого работает данный плагин? :) Отпишитесь, я тоже поставлю :)

Работает, если есть лицензия.

[spoiler]Я VS VolksWagen POLO, МКАД
Психанул или моя русская рулетка
http://cs618330.vk.me/v618330946/8c16/hEeTVyYjCZw.jpg - Ой как плохо поступил[/spoiler]
Аватара пользователя
BaHeK
Скриптер
 
Сообщения: 544
Зарегистрирован: 26 авг 2011, 19:32
Откуда: Москва
Благодарил (а): 403 раз.
Поблагодарили: 261 раз.
Опыт программирования: Больше трех лет
Языки программирования: Counter-Strike 1.6

Re: SuperBan 4.12 Quckly modification

Сообщение Evgen {22Rus} » 06 фев 2014, 22:47

BaHeK, лицензия у меня от Ильдара, но этот плагин у меня почему-то не работает. Сейчас ещё раз попробую.

Добавлено спустя 11 минут 36 секунд:
BaHeK,
Код: Выделить всё
L 02/06/2014 - 22:45:50: [AMXX] Displaying debug trace (plugin "superban.amxx")
L 02/06/2014 - 22:45:50: [AMXX] Run time error 3: stack error
L 02/06/2014 - 22:45:50: [AMXX]    [0] superban.sma::CheckLicense_ (line 410)

Что-то с лицензией походу, кому писать?)
Не забывай отблагодарить кнопкой "Спасибо" :)
Ну или...
[spoiler]Также не откажусь от материальной помощи :)
R117018462390 - Webmoney (Аттестован)
41001534741802 - Yandex money (Идентифицирован)[/spoiler]
Аватара пользователя
Evgen {22Rus}
 
Сообщения: 67
Зарегистрирован: 09 окт 2012, 18:17
Откуда: Рубцовск
Благодарил (а): 8 раз.
Поблагодарили: 8 раз.
Опыт программирования: Около года
Языки программирования: Counter-Strike 1.6

Re: SuperBan 4.12 Quckly modification

Сообщение quckly » 06 фев 2014, 22:54

Обновил версию в шапке. Лицензия через сайт работает 100%, через файл не известно.
Аватара пользователя
quckly
Скриптер
 
Сообщения: 403
Зарегистрирован: 20 ноя 2009, 10:03
Благодарил (а): 41 раз.
Поблагодарили: 243 раз.
Опыт программирования: Около 6 месяцев
Языки программирования: Counter-Strike 1.6

Re: SuperBan 4.12 Quckly modification

Сообщение Hollisch » 14 фев 2014, 05:19

request:
1) Добавить квар отключения rateid
2) Добавить квар отключения проверки на протектор (Я так понимаю, в последней версии ты его добавил?)
3) Добавить функционал в блок unban, снимать баны могут:
* Администратор с определенным флагом.
* Администратор выдавший этот бан.
4) Forward-Native сообщений оповещений о бане (для игроков).

Пожелание: Приятно видеть, что список "изначально" проделанной работы достаточно велик, но хотелось бы видеть внятный чейнджлог постоянно :)
А вообще, молодец.
Аватара пользователя
Hollisch
 
Сообщения: 6
Зарегистрирован: 27 фев 2012, 02:01
Благодарил (а): 9 раз.
Поблагодарили: 3 раз.
Языки программирования: Counter-Strike 1.6

Пред.След.

Вернуться в Утвержденные плагины

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2

cron